Python cmath.log10() 方法
定义和用法
cmath.log10()
方法返回复数的以 10 为底的对数。
存在一个分支切割,从 0 沿负实轴到 -∞,从上面连续。
实例
计算一个复数的以 10 为底的对数:
# 导入 cmath 库 import cmath # 打印复数的以 10 为底的对数值 print (cmath.log10(2+ 3j)) print (cmath.log10(1+ 2j))
语法
cmath.log10(x)
参数
参数 | 描述 |
---|---|
x |
必需。指定要计算以 10 为底的对数的值。 如果值为 0 或负数,则返回 ValueError。 如果值不是数字,则返回 TypeError。 |
技术细节
返回值: | 复数,表示数的以 10 为底的对数。 |
---|---|
Python 版本: | 1.5 |